ELEVIDYS
delandistrogene moxeparvovec-rokl · KIT · Sarepta Therapeutics, Inc.
Elevidys is an intravenous gene therapy used to treat certain types of muscular dystrophy. It works by delivering a functional gene to help muscle cells produce the proteins needed for normal muscle function.
